Susan Roberts

Castle Stalker

The ‘Castle Stalker’ image was shot during a long weekend in Fort William spent with my camera club back in the summer of 2014. It was captured on the return
journey home via Oban. I exited the A828 and walked along a disused railway track to a deserted beach with a very close vantage point for Castle Stalker and the
southern end of Loch Linnhe . I shot from many different angles but was over-ridingly attracted to the image that contained the rock in the foreground.

2015Landscape CategoryCommended
